| Reina ( my four month old pup) has been waking up in the morning and immediately barfing on my bed. (she sleeps with me). I was thinking it was because she has gone all night without food and her hunger is making her tummy upset, but the last time she threw up, she threw up food. Maybe she gets too warm? It is summer and I don't have a.c...any ideas on the topic? |

| My guess would be an empty stomach if it's bile most of the time. One of my dogs has a tendency to vomit early in the morning and in the afternoon because of an empty stomach. I have to give her a treat at bedtime and early afternoon and as long as I do that she doesn't throw up. | My girl Nova does the same thing, we talked it over with our vet who said it was normal to see Bile in the morning and as you've been saying is just little Reina's way of telling her Mommy that she's hungry. Although like it was mentioned above, Nova will also vomit in the morning if she got into something the night before that she shouldn't have had (plastic and other such things that we didn't notice were left where she could find them). If its just an occasional thing I woudn't be too worried, but if its an almost every day thing there could be other issues.
Nova also loves pulling the stuffing (and squeakers) out of her toys, but the stuffing always makes her tummy feel yucky if she eats some |
